4:00 Wedding....dinner expected? — The Knot Community
2011年12月1日 · I'd expect dinner at a 4pm wedding. Personally I don't usually eat until much later, but if I saw 4 I'd imagine the ceremony going til at least 4:30, then an hour cocktail hour, and dinner beginning at 5:30, which is a normal early dinner time. I've been to one wedding that started at 4, and that was more or less their timeline.
